A Group of Unknown Order refers to a collection of cryptographic elements where the mathematical structure or size of the underlying group is not publicly known or easily computable. This property is utilized in certain advanced cryptographic schemes to achieve privacy and security. It presents computational challenges for adversaries attempting to break the system. This concept is relevant in zero-knowledge proofs and privacy-preserving protocols.
